JOB DESCRIPTION
As the principal software engineer, you will lead the AMS360 teams in enhancing the AMS360 application. You will be hands on, involved in designing new features and maintaining existing functionality within AMS360 to achieve the vision through active mentoring, technical decision-making, and facilitating company-wide collaboration. You will coordinate with product management leaders and utilize customer feedback or data to provide expert advice on technical leadership while writing and altering portfolio-wide requirements and specifications and creating cross-product integrated solutions. You will also provide expertise in code reviews and grooming and provide feedback and advice in correcting issues discovered along with identifying patterns and other related issues. All of this will be accomplished with cutting edge, lean-agile, software development methodologies. Core Requirements and Responsibilities:
Qualifications:
We need product developers that have:
Experience with implementing software development principles and design patterns, preferably .Net
Capability to design and provide technical guidance on cross-product solutions independently
Have 10+ years of professional experience with .NET and common frameworks
Advance expertise with SQL database
Are in-tune with high performance and high availability design/programming
Have experience in security best practices for software and data platforms
Design 'perfect-fit' solutions with engineering teams and business units to drive business growth and customer delight
Enjoy solving problems through the entire application stack
Are interested and capable of learning other programming languages as needed.
